QTreeWidge
时间: 2024-04-05 13:06:22 浏览: 20
QTreeWidget是Qt框架中的一个控件,用于显示树形结构的数据。可以通过添加根节点和子节点来构建树形结构。在给QTreeWidget添加根节点时,可以使用MainWindow类中的AddTreeRoot函数。该函数会检查是否已经存在同名的根节点,如果存在则返回该节点的指针,如果不存在则创建一个新的根节点,并设置节点的文本、数据等属性。\[1\]
如果要给一个父节点添加子节点,可以使用MainWindow类中的addChildItem函数。该函数会检查是否已经存在同名的子节点,如果存在则返回该节点的指针,如果不存在则创建一个新的子节点,并设置节点的文本、数据等属性。\[2\]
另外,可以使用Qt Designer(界面设计师)来生成QT界面,通过拖拽控件的方式直观地创建程序的界面。在生成界面后,可以通过编写代码来实现程序的逻辑。\[3\]
请注意,以上引用内容是关于QTreeWidget的相关函数和使用步骤的说明。
#### 引用[.reference_title]
- *1* *2* [Qt:QTreeWidge添加节点](https://blog.csdn.net/weixin_45483780/article/details/129036779)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[以SqLite数据库中表创建无限级 QTreeWidge](https://blog.csdn.net/weixin_48261942/article/details/129192612)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]